البرمجة

حلول لمشكلة تحول رموز PHP في HTML إلى تعليقات: دليل الإصلاح

عندما تواجه مشكلة في تضمين رمز PHP في ملف HTML الخاص بك ويتحول إلى تعليق، فقد يكون هناك عدة أسباب قد تؤدي إلى هذا السلوك غير المتوقع. لنقم بتحليل الوضع والبحث عن حلاً لهذه المشكلة المحتملة.

أولًا وقبل كل شيء، يجب التحقق من أن بيئة الخادم الخاصة بك مثل WampServer تعمل بشكل صحيح وأن خوادم PHP و Apache قيد التشغيل بشكل سليم. قد تكون المشكلة تكمن في تكوين الخادم أو وجود خطأ في تركيبه.

ثانيًا، تحقق من نحو الرمز الخاص بك. في الشيفرة التي قدمتها، لاحظ أنك استخدمت علامات الاقتران “<--" و "-->” التي تُستخدم عادة لتعليقات HTML. يبدو أن هذا هو مصدر المشكلة. عندما تستخدمها حول رمز PHP، قد يتم تفسير الكود بأكمله على أنه تعليق HTML ولا يتم تنفيذه كرمز PHP.

لحل هذه المشكلة، قم بتصحيح نحو الرمز الخاص بك بإزالة علامات التعليق وتركيز على استخدام “” لنهايته. إليك كيف يجب أن يبدو كودك:

php
echo "hello"; ?>

بهذه الطريقة، يتم تفسير الكود بشكل صحيح كـ PHP وليس كتعليق HTML.

علاوة على ذلك، تأكد من حفظ ملف الكود بامتداد “.php” بدلاً من “.html” إذا كنت تستخدم PHP في ملف HTML، حتى يتم تفسير الكود كـ PHP بشكل صحيح.

أتمنى أن تجد هذه الإرشادات مفيدة لحل مشكلتك، ولا تتردد في طرح المزيد من الأسئلة إذا كنت بحاجة إلى مساعدة إضافية.

المزيد من المعلومات

بالطبع، دعنا نعمق في الموضوع أكثر لفهم الأسباب المحتملة لتحول رمز PHP الخاص بك إلى تعليق في ملف HTML. قد يكون هناك عدة عوامل يجب أخذها في اعتبارك:

  1. إعدادات الخادم (Server Settings):

    • تحقق من أن خادم WampServer الخاص بك يعمل بشكل صحيح.
    • تأكد من أن الإعدادات الخاصة بـ PHP مكونة بشكل صحيح في ملفات الإعدادات (مثل php.ini).
  2. توجيه الملفات (File Handling):

    • تأكد من أن الملف الذي تعمل عليه لديه الامتداد الصحيح، وهو “.php”، وليس “.html”.
    • تحقق من أنه لا توجد مشكلات في توجيه الملفات عبر خوادم WampServer.
  3. أخطاء في الكود (Code Errors):

    • فحص الكود بدقة للتأكد من عدم وجود أخطاء نحوية أو أخطاء تنفيذية.
    • تأكد من أنك قمت بفتح وإغلاق البلوكات البرمجية بشكل صحيح باستخدام ““.
  4. الإصدارات والتوافق (Versions and Compatibility):

    • تحقق من توافق إصدارات PHP مع WampServer وApache المستخدمين.
    • قد يحدث تضارب في الإصدارات قد يؤدي إلى سلوك غير متوقع.
  5. سجلات الأخطاء (Error Logs):

    • فحص سجلات الأخطاء للوحة التحكم في WampServer للاطلاع على أي رسائل خطأ محتملة.
    • قد تقدم هذه السجلات أدلة إضافية حول سبب تحول الكود إلى تعليق.
  6. تحقق من البيئة النصية (Scripting Environment):

    • تأكد من أن البيئة النصية الخاصة بك قادرة على تشغيل الرموز PHP بشكل صحيح.

باختصار، يفضل فحص كل هذه النقاط للتأكد من عدم وجود أي مشكلة في إعدادات الخادم أو الكود نفسه. في حال استمرار المشكلة، يمكنك مشاركة المزيد من التفاصيل حول إعدادات الخادم والرمز المستخدم لنتمكن من تقديم مساعدة أكثر دقة.

مقالات ذات صلة

زر الذهاب إلى الأعلى
إغلاق

أنت تستخدم إضافة Adblock

يرجى تعطيل مانع الإعلانات حيث أن موقعنا غير مزعج ولا بأس من عرض الأعلانات لك فهي تعتبر كمصدر دخل لنا و دعم مقدم منك لنا لنستمر في تقديم المحتوى المناسب و المفيد لك فلا تبخل بدعمنا عزيزي الزائر